Before: HUG, Chief Judge.

Upon the vote of a majority of nonre-cused regular active judges of this court, it is ordered that this case be reheard by the en banc court pursuant to Circuit Rule 35-3. The three-judge panel opinion, In re Gruntz, No. 97-55379, slip op. at 4611, 177 F.3d 728 (9th Cir. May 19, 1999), is withdrawn.
